Tiger’s Eye Gemstone: Legends and Facts
Tiger Eye (also called Tiger's Eye) is a semi-precious gemstone from the quartz family. It is easily spotted by it's luminescent band that resembles a cat's eye (or tiger in this case!!) Mostly you see these in brown tones, but they can also be seen in red tones or yellow tones... all with the tell-tale band. I love working with this gem. Red Creek Jasper; Fascinating Facts and Legends
My New FAVORITE gemstone! Red Creek Jasper was discovered in Northwestern China about 5 years ago. It is name 'Red Creek' after the stream that runs through the mining area. The colors and hues are out of this world. I have seen multiple shades of Red/Burgundy, Green, Browns and Yellows. Each piece is virtually different from the next.
